tHiNg wrote:I bought 2 mini

I bought 2 mini DP ->DVI active adapters only to have one fail after about 10 minutes. I was then fortunate to find mini dp to dp cables (no adapter, just a cable with mini dp at one end and dp at the other). Definitely the best solution as far as I am concerned, so worth hunting around for ...

Abram wrote:You need at least

You need at least one display to be connected via a Mini-DP port. You will need an active mini-DP to VGA adaptor.

Good to know.

I'm noticing that most of these active adapters are $20 bucks or more. I'm assuming the safe bet is to get one that AMD lists on its dongle support page ...
